Who can register for the 2012 Samoan Quota?

To register for the Samoan Quota the principal registrant (the person who signs the registration form and who would be the principal applicant if invited to apply for residence) must:

  • be a Samoan citizen (having been born in Samoa or born overseas to a Samoan citizen who was born in Samoa); and
  • register for the ballot for the Samoan Quota Scheme within the official registration period; and
  • be aged between 18 and 45 inclusive at the registration closing date.

Note: If you are in New Zealand you must be in New Zealand lawfully to register.

How do I register?

Along with your completed (and signed) Samoan Quota Scheme Registration Form (INZ 1086) PDF also include a photocopy of your birth certificate, and a photocopy of your partner’s and dependent children’s birth certificates who are included in your registration form. You should also include the date of birth of all immediate family members included in your registration form.

 

Your registration form must be received by Immigration New Zealand no later than 30 April 2012 or it cannot be accepted.

 

Note: Only one registration form from each family is allowed. If you, or any of the family members listed in your registration, are found to be included in another registration that is already accepted, the other registration(s) will not be accepted.

You must send your registration form by post or courier.

Ballot draw

One month after the closure of the registration period, we conduct an electronic draw in which registrations are drawn randomly until the appropriate number of people to meet the quota of available places is met.

 

If you were successful in the ballot draw and you are eligible to apply for residence under the Samoan Quota Scheme you’ll be notified within the month following the draw and invited to make an application for residence.

 

If invited to apply for residence, you must apply for residence within six months of written advice from Immigration New Zealand.
